| What It Does | Genworlds provides a Python-based framework that abstracts away the complexities of multi-agent system development, allowing users to define agents with specific roles, goals, and tools. It facilitates the creation of environments where these agents can operate, communicate, and learn from interactions. The platform handles the underlying orchestration, memory management, and tool integration, streamlining the process of building intelligent, collaborative AI solutions. | Llamabot allows users to build AI chatbots by uploading proprietary data sources such as PDFs, website URLs, or text files. It processes this information to train a conversational AI model, which can then answer questions and provide information based solely on the provided context. The resulting chatbot can be customized in appearance and embedded seamlessly into websites or shared via direct links, acting as an intelligent assistant. |
